Meet Our 2026 FIXED Partners

Each of these organizations addresses a vital need in our community. Here’s a little bit about why we’ve chosen to support them:

  • Tharros Place Named after the Greek word for "courage," Tharros Place provides a safe haven and residential care for adolescent survivors of human trafficking. Their trauma-informed approach helps young girls navigate their journey toward healing and a brighter future.

  • Shelter from the Rain This wonderful non-profit empowers single mothers by providing everything from baby supplies and household items to mental health resources and mentorship. They are a literal "shelter" for moms navigating the storms of life, helping them reach economic independence.

  • Catholic Cathedral Basilica of St. John the Baptist An icon of the Savannah skyline, the Cathedral is more than just a breathtaking architectural landmark. Their outreach programs, including the St. Vincent de Paul Society and various food distribution efforts, provide a lifeline to local families in need of food and emergency assistance.

  • Union Mission For nearly 90 years, Union Mission has been on the front lines of the fight against homelessness in Savannah. From emergency housing and hot meals at their Day Center to behavioral health services, they provide the tools individuals need to rebuild their lives.

In 2025, Savannah Bike Tours donated a total of $8,104 to a diverse group of non-profits working tirelessly across the Hostess City.

Our 2025 Beneficiaries

We carefully select organizations that reflect the spirit, history, and future of Savannah and the surrounding Lowcountry. This year’s donations supported:

  • Youth & Empowerment: Girls on the Run of South Georgia, Frank Callen Boys and Girls Club, and Greenbriar Children’s Center.

  • Health & Advocacy: CURE Childhood Cancer, Tharros Place, and Chatham County Citizen Advocacy.

  • Community Support: Savannah Widows Society, Catholic Charities, and First City Pride Center.

  • Safety & Heritage: Lodge 7 Fraternal Order of Police and the Historic Savannah Foundation.

  • Environment & Animals: Tybee Island Marine Science Center and Grr Pet Rescue.

Savannah, Georgia, a city steeped in history, played a significant role in the Civil Rights Movement. Including Second African Baptist Church, located right around the corner from our shop, where General Rufus Saxton publically addressed former slaves and church members about General Sherman’s Special Field Order #15, better known as the famous “forty acres and a mule” proclamation. Many years later,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. would preach his “I Have a Dream” sermon in the same Second African Baptist Church, an address he repeated during his famous march on Washington, D.C. in 1963.
